Class ListApprovalRequestsResponse.Builder (2.54.0)

public static final class ListApprovalRequestsResponse.Builder extends GeneratedMessageV3.Builder<ListApprovalRequestsResponse.Builder> implements ListApprovalRequestsResponseOrBuilder

Response to listing of ApprovalRequest objects.

Protobuf type google.cloud.accessapproval.v1.ListApprovalRequestsResponse

Static Methods

getDescriptor()

public static final Descriptors.Descriptor getDescriptor()
Returns
Type Description
Descriptor

Methods

addAllApprovalRequests(Iterable<? extends ApprovalRequest> values)

public ListApprovalRequestsResponse.Builder addAllApprovalRequests(Iterable<? extends ApprovalRequest> values)

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Parameter
Name Description
values Iterable<? extends com.google.cloud.accessapproval.v1.ApprovalRequest>
Returns
Type Description
ListApprovalRequestsResponse.Builder

addApprovalRequests(ApprovalRequest value)

public ListApprovalRequestsResponse.Builder addApprovalRequests(ApprovalRequest value)

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Parameter
Name Description
value ApprovalRequest
Returns
Type Description
ListApprovalRequestsResponse.Builder

addApprovalRequests(ApprovalRequest.Builder builderForValue)

public ListApprovalRequestsResponse.Builder addApprovalRequests(ApprovalRequest.Builder builderForValue)

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Parameter
Name Description
builderForValue ApprovalRequest.Builder
Returns
Type Description
ListApprovalRequestsResponse.Builder

addApprovalRequests(int index, ApprovalRequest value)

public ListApprovalRequestsResponse.Builder addApprovalRequests(int index, ApprovalRequest value)

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Parameters
Name Description
index int
value ApprovalRequest
Returns
Type Description
ListApprovalRequestsResponse.Builder

addApprovalRequests(int index, ApprovalRequest.Builder builderForValue)

public ListApprovalRequestsResponse.Builder addApprovalRequests(int index, ApprovalRequest.Builder builderForValue)

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Parameters
Name Description
index int
builderForValue ApprovalRequest.Builder
Returns
Type Description
ListApprovalRequestsResponse.Builder

addApprovalRequestsBuilder()

public ApprovalRequest.Builder addApprovalRequestsBuilder()

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Returns
Type Description
ApprovalRequest.Builder

addApprovalRequestsBuilder(int index)

public ApprovalRequest.Builder addApprovalRequestsBuilder(int index)

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Parameter
Name Description
index int
Returns
Type Description
ApprovalRequest.Builder

addRepeatedField(Descriptors.FieldDescriptor field, Object value)

public ListApprovalRequestsResponse.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Parameters
Name Description
field FieldDescriptor
value Object
Returns
Type Description
ListApprovalRequestsResponse.Builder
Overrides

build()

public ListApprovalRequestsResponse build()
Returns
Type Description
ListApprovalRequestsResponse

buildPartial()

public ListApprovalRequestsResponse buildPartial()
Returns
Type Description
ListApprovalRequestsResponse

clear()

public ListApprovalRequestsResponse.Builder clear()
Returns
Type Description
ListApprovalRequestsResponse.Builder
Overrides

clearApprovalRequests()

public ListApprovalRequestsResponse.Builder clearApprovalRequests()

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Returns
Type Description
ListApprovalRequestsResponse.Builder

clearField(Descriptors.FieldDescriptor field)

public ListApprovalRequestsResponse.Builder clearField(Descriptors.FieldDescriptor field)
Parameter
Name Description
field FieldDescriptor
Returns
Type Description
ListApprovalRequestsResponse.Builder
Overrides

clearNextPageToken()

public ListApprovalRequestsResponse.Builder clearNextPageToken()

Token to retrieve the next page of results, or empty if there are no more.

string next_page_token = 2;

Returns
Type Description
ListApprovalRequestsResponse.Builder

This builder for chaining.

clearOneof(Descriptors.OneofDescriptor oneof)

public ListApprovalRequestsResponse.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Parameter
Name Description
oneof OneofDescriptor
Returns
Type Description
ListApprovalRequestsResponse.Builder
Overrides

clone()

public ListApprovalRequestsResponse.Builder clone()
Returns
Type Description
ListApprovalRequestsResponse.Builder
Overrides

getApprovalRequests(int index)

public ApprovalRequest getApprovalRequests(int index)

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Parameter
Name Description
index int
Returns
Type Description
ApprovalRequest

getApprovalRequestsBuilder(int index)

public ApprovalRequest.Builder getApprovalRequestsBuilder(int index)

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Parameter
Name Description
index int
Returns
Type Description
ApprovalRequest.Builder

getApprovalRequestsBuilderList()

public List<ApprovalRequest.Builder> getApprovalRequestsBuilderList()

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Returns
Type Description
List<Builder>

getApprovalRequestsCount()

public int getApprovalRequestsCount()

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Returns
Type Description
int

getApprovalRequestsList()

public List<ApprovalRequest> getApprovalRequestsList()

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Returns
Type Description
List<ApprovalRequest>

getApprovalRequestsOrBuilder(int index)

public ApprovalRequestOrBuilder getApprovalRequestsOrBuilder(int index)

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Parameter
Name Description
index int
Returns
Type Description
ApprovalRequestOrBuilder

getApprovalRequestsOrBuilderList()

public List<? extends ApprovalRequestOrBuilder> getApprovalRequestsOrBuilderList()

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Returns
Type Description
List<? extends com.google.cloud.accessapproval.v1.ApprovalRequestOrBuilder>

getDefaultInstanceForType()

public ListApprovalRequestsResponse getDefaultInstanceForType()
Returns
Type Description
ListApprovalRequestsResponse

getDescriptorForType()

public Descriptors.Descriptor getDescriptorForType()
Returns
Type Description
Descriptor
Overrides

getNextPageToken()

public String getNextPageToken()

Token to retrieve the next page of results, or empty if there are no more.

string next_page_token = 2;

Returns
Type Description
String

The nextPageToken.

getNextPageTokenBytes()

public ByteString getNextPageTokenBytes()

Token to retrieve the next page of results, or empty if there are no more.

string next_page_token = 2;

Returns
Type Description
ByteString

The bytes for nextPageToken.

internalGetFieldAccessorTable()

prot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Returns
Type Description
FieldAccessorTable
Overrides

isInitialized()

public final boolean isInitialized()
Returns
Type Description
boolean
Overrides

mergeFrom(ListApprovalRequestsResponse other)

public ListApprovalRequestsResponse.Builder mergeFrom(ListApprovalRequestsResponse other)
Parameter
Name Description
other ListApprovalRequestsResponse
Returns
Type Description
ListApprovalRequestsResponse.Builder

m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)

public ListApprovalRequestsResponse.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Name Description
input CodedInputStream
extensionRegistry ExtensionRegistryLite
Returns
Type Description
ListApprovalRequestsResponse.Builder
Overrides
Exceptions
Type Description
IOException

mergeFrom(Message other)

public ListApprovalRequestsResponse.Builder mergeFrom(Message other)
Parameter
Name Description
other Message
Returns
Type Description
ListApprovalRequestsResponse.Builder
Overrides

mergeUnknownFields(UnknownFieldSet unknownFields)

public final ListApprovalRequestsResponse.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Parameter
Name Description
unknownFields UnknownFieldSet
Returns
Type Description
ListApprovalRequestsResponse.Builder
Overrides

removeApprovalRequests(int index)

public ListApprovalRequestsResponse.Builder removeApprovalRequests(int index)

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Parameter
Name Description
index int
Returns
Type Description
ListApprovalRequestsResponse.Builder

setApprovalRequests(int index, ApprovalRequest value)

public ListApprovalRequestsResponse.Builder setApprovalRequests(int index, ApprovalRequest value)

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Parameters
Name Description
index int
value ApprovalRequest
Returns
Type Description
ListApprovalRequestsResponse.Builder

setApprovalRequests(int index, ApprovalRequest.Builder builderForValue)

public ListApprovalRequestsResponse.Builder setApprovalRequests(int index, ApprovalRequest.Builder builderForValue)

Approval request details.

repeated .google.cloud.accessapproval.v1.ApprovalRequest approval_requests = 1;

Parameters
Name Description
index int
builderForValue ApprovalRequest.Builder
Returns
Type Description
ListApprovalRequestsResponse.Builder

setField(Descriptors.FieldDescriptor field, Object value)

public ListApprovalRequestsResponse.Builder setField(Descriptors.FieldDescriptor field, Object value)
Parameters
Name Description
field FieldDescriptor
value Object
Returns
Type Description
ListApprovalRequestsResponse.Builder
Overrides

setNextPageToken(String value)

public ListApprovalRequestsResponse.Builder setNextPageToken(String value)

Token to retrieve the next page of results, or empty if there are no more.

string next_page_token = 2;

Parameter
Name Description
value String

The nextPageToken to set.

Returns
Type Description
ListApprovalRequestsResponse.Builder

This builder for chaining.

setNextPageTokenBytes(ByteString value)

public ListApprovalRequestsResponse.Builder setNextPageTokenBytes(ByteString value)

Token to retrieve the next page of results, or empty if there are no more.

string next_page_token = 2;

Parameter
Name Description
value ByteString

The bytes for nextPageToken to set.

Returns
Type Description
ListApprovalRequestsResponse.Builder

This builder for chaining.

set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)

public ListApprovalRequestsResponse.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Parameters
Name Description
field FieldDescriptor
index int
value Object
Returns
Type Description
ListApprovalRequestsResponse.Builder
Overrides

setUnknownFields(UnknownFieldSet unknownFields)

public final ListApprovalRequestsResponse.Builder setUnknownFields(UnknownFieldSet unknownFields)
Parameter
Name Description
unknownFields UnknownFieldSet
Returns
Type Description
ListApprovalRequestsResponse.Builder
Overrides